Asked to name their favorite city, many Americans would select San Francisco. San Francisco began as a【S1】______Spanish outpost located on a magnificent bay. The town was little more than a village serving ranchers when the United States took【S2】______of it in 1846 during the war with Mexico.
San Francisco【S3】______into a city overnight because of the nearby discovery of gold in 1848. A【S4】______rush to California took place. Wagon trains plodded their【S5】______way across 2,000 miles of prairie and mountains, while hundreds of sailing vessels made the【S6】______hazardous trip around the Horn. The vessels disgorged thousands of passengers then the crews【S7】______their ships and hundreds of vessels were left to rot in the Bay. Within two years, California had enough population to become a【S8】______and San Francisco was for many years the hub of that newly-arrived population.
The city’s present【S9】______is due to an excellent climate, an easy style of living, good food, and numerous tourist attractions. The city is famous for its cable cars which "clang and bang" up the【S10】______hills, and for its excellent seafood stalls along the wharf. Most visitors arriving from nations in the Pacific Basin spend several days getting to know the town.
